Nursing is a critical profession, a fact only accentuated by the COVID-19 pandemic. Despite the essential work that nurses perform each day, their contributions often go unacknowledged, and students may not feel encouraged to pursue a career in nursing.

Demand for nurses is expected to increase by 15% in 2024. Meanwhile, a growing nursing shortage threatens the public health of the United States.

As many nurses from the Baby Boomer generation retire, not enough new nurses are entering the field to replace them. There are currently around 3.9 million nurses, and by 2030, almost 1 million of them are expected to have retired. Encouraging undergraduate nursing students and students in graduate nursing programs to continue on their career path is imperative to providing adequate healthcare to all Americans.

For context, in Intensive Care Units with a below-target amount of nurses, mortality rates rose by 2% to 7%, and mortality increased by 12% for non-ICU patients. A shortage of nurses also creates overcrowding in emergency rooms, a problem that 92% of emergency departments are already experiencing, which leads to longer waiting times that can prove to be fatal for patients in need.
